The tiles are the 25mmx25mm glass mosaic and aren't very thick. I'm not totaaly sure they are suitable to put on a floor? or is it just a case of making sure I use the right adhesive with them and they'll be fine?

hi gaz..hope your hols were good...

The tiles will be ok for floor use...use bal mosaic fix for your project ......

BAL Mosaic-Fix Tile Adhesive
mosaic_fix.jpg

A bright white, non-slip, water and frost-resistant, cementitious wall and floor tile adhesive specially formulated for fixing mosaic tiles including glass mosaics. It is also suitable for fixing ceramic wall and floor tiles, metal or glass tiles, marble, terrazzo, and natural stone in interior and exterior locations. Suitable for use in swimming pools. Can be used on most surfaces including MDF (in internal dry areas).

tell the customer to arrange the plumber herself..if you know one..by all means recommend them. I say this because that way if anything goes wrong with the plumbing/plumber it has nothing to do with you as the contract is between your customer and the plumber. If you arrange the plumber...and anything goes wrong you're liable.
